Key Features and Technical Specifications

1. Class AB Amplifier Architecture

  • The DRV601RTJR utilizes a Class AB design, which combines the low distortion of Class A amplifiers with the efficiency of Class B amplifiers. This results in pristine audio quality with reduced power consumption.
  • Features 2-channel (stereo) output, ensuring balanced and immersive sound reproduction.

2. Wide Supply Voltage Range (1.8V ~ 4.5V)

  • Operates efficiently within a broad voltage range of 1.8V to 4.5V, making it compatible with various power sources, including batteries and regulated power supplies.
  • Ideal for portable devices such as smartphones, Bluetooth speakers, and handheld audio players.

3. Advanced Protection Mechanisms

  • Depop Protection: Eliminates annoying popping noises during power transitions.
  • Short-Circuit and Thermal Protection: Ensures the IC remains safe under fault conditions, enhancing durability.
  • Shutdown Mode: Reduces idle power consumption, extending battery life in portable applications.

4. Compact and Efficient Design

  • Packaged in a 20-QFN (4x4) surface-mount format, the DRV601RTJR is perfect for space-constrained PCB designs.
  • Exposed pad enhances thermal management, ensuring stable performance even under heavy loads.

5. Wide Operating Temperature Range (-40 C ~ 85 C)

  • Designed to perform reliably in extreme environments, from freezing cold to high heat, making it suitable for automotive and industrial applications.
